In some parts of Italy it is from trash left on the street poses a real problem both from the point of view environment that of urban design. This also happens in the municipality Santa Croce Camerinain the province of Ragusa, where the municipality has decided to confiscate all vehicles which is used to dump garbage on the street.

The plan approved by the decision of the city council provides, in addition to the seizure, the seizure of the vehicle in the event that the fine is not paid. For the mayor of the city, Peppe Dimartinorepresents a drastic but necessary choice to contain the problem and reduce the threat of safety of people and the environment. The mayor himself explains via a post on Facebook that fines are not enough to curb the phenomenon.

In order to reduce the waste problem, it is necessary to pay attention to the education and awareness of citizens, but also and above all to to recycle and reuse. The latest Legambiente report Municipalities of Ricolon shows that of the 7,904 municipalities surveyed, only 590 follow the recycling rules, of which 66.3% in the north, 28% in the south and 5.4% in central Italy.
